How To Choose The Best Bridal Jewelry
Bridal jewelry is not a one-size-fits-all purchase. The right choice hinges on three factors: the stone material, the metal base and finish, and the style’s compatibility with your dress neckline and overall aesthetic. Understanding these will save you from disappointment when the pieces arrive.
Stone Material: Sparkle Source and Durability
The main stone defines the jewelry’s brilliance. Cubic zirconia (CZ) offers high sparkle at a budget-friendly cost but may cloud over time with exposure to lotions and oils. Moissanite provides a fire and brilliance closer to diamond and is far more scratch-resistant than CZ. Swarovski crystals are precision-cut, lead-free glass with exceptional clarity and refraction, ideal for maximum light performance in a controlled manufacturing environment. Natural diamonds are the hardest option but come at a significantly higher price point. For bridal use, moissanite and Swarovski crystal offer the best balance of visual impact and longevity.
Metal Base and Plating
The underlying metal determines both comfort and tarnish resistance. Sterling silver (925) is a standard for quality but requires periodic polishing to maintain its luster. Rhodium plating over silver or brass adds a highly reflective, scratch-resistant surface that prevents tarnishing and mimics the look of white gold. Hypoallergenic properties matter for brides with sensitive skin—nickel-free alloys and rhodium finishes are your safest bet. A thicker plating (2-3 microns) will hold up longer against daily wear and repeated cleaning.
Neckline Compatibility and Earring Drop Style
Your jewelry should frame your face and dress neckline, not compete with it. V-neck or sweetheart necklines pair best with a pendant that follows the V-shape. Strapless or off-shoulder gowns allow for statement earrings and a shorter choker-length necklace. High collars or illusion necklines benefit from simple stud earrings or a lariat drop that falls below the collarbone. Note the earring closure type—push-back clasps are standard, but screw-back or lever-back options offer more security for all-day wear.
